The area I'm struggling to understand is how to create pages in the main site navigation menu that are used to present static information in a style that is consistent with the forum but much less cluttered - such as the XF.com home page or buy page.

I've worked out how to get content into a page node, but that's inside the node tree. I want to do this above the node tree in the main nav menu to create a site that includes a forum.
 
Our home and buy pages are completely external to the forum.
While they are based on the same framework, they are just static pages constructed using HTML & CSS.

If you want pages outside the forum, you would just do the same thing and manually create the pages and then link to them from within the forum by editing the navigation template.
